AutoGyro Europe MTOsport

The AutoGyro MTOsport is a gyrocopter company AutoGyro from Hildesheim .

The MTOsport is a further development of the previous model HTC MT-03 - the first ultralight gyrocopter approved in Germany - from the manufacturer HTC, from which the company AutoGyro emerged. It belongs to the family of air sports equipment and is a two-seat aircraft in tandem arrangement. According to German law, the maximum take-off weight is 450 kg. The identical MTOsport is approved in Great Britain up to 500 kg MTOW (Maximum Take-Off Weight).

Like all gyroplanes, the MTOsport is characterized by extremely short take-off and landing distances ( ESTOL ) and an improved speed range from 30 km / h (minimum speed without sinking) to 185 km / h Vne (velocity never exceed) compared to the previous model.

The improved performance data of the MTOsport result from the aerodynamic optimization of the predecessor model: Due to the slight forward inclination of the rotor mast and a corresponding raising and forward inclination of the tail unit, the nose of the airframe has to be lowered much less during fast cruise than in the previous model and the MTOsport is therefore more horizontal. This comparatively minor modification significantly reduces the drag, which is higher than that of fixed-wing aircraft, and enables a top speed to be 25 km / h faster. The modification also brings an improvement in the general flight characteristics such as reduced vortex formation, improved vibration behavior and better gust stability (which is generally very high in gyroplanes due to the gyroscopic stability of the rotor).

Technical specifications

MTOSport 2017

The MTOsport is offered with three different Rotax engines, namely the Rotax 912 ULS , the Rotax 914 S (with turbocharger ) and the 915 .

  • Power: Rotax 912 ULS: 73.5 kW (100 PS); Rotax 914 S: 84.5 kW (115 PS)
  • Empty weight: 240.8 to 247.0 kg
  • Take-off weight: max. 450 kg
  • V NE : 195 km / h
  • V trip : 145 km / h
  • Speed ​​for best range: 120 km / h
  • V min : 30 km / h
  • Rate of climb : 3.4 to 6 m / s
  • Take-off run: 80 to 120 m
  • Landing distance: 0 to 20 m
  • Fuel consumption: 15 l / h at 120 km / h
  • Tank volume: 34 l; with additional tank 68 l
  • Length: 5080 mm
  • Width: 1880 mm
  • Height: 2710 mm
  • Rotor diameter: 8400 mm (standard rotor)
